射精一区欧美专区|国产精品66xx|亚洲视频一区导航|日韩欧美人妻精品中文|超碰婷婷xxnx|日韩无码综合激情|特级黄片一区二区|四虎日韩成人A√|久久精品内谢片|亚洲成a人无码电影

您現(xiàn)在的位置:首頁(yè) > IT認(rèn)證 > oracle認(rèn)證 >

Oracle10gRAC裸設(shè)備管理方式切換


由于先前這套測(cè)試環(huán)境的使用綁定方式是直接使用設(shè)備符號(hào)來映射的,這樣存在一個(gè)問題,由于空間不足增加了硬盤,結(jié)果新增加的硬盤占用了原來的ocr的/dev/sdb,這樣就會(huì)導(dǎo)致整個(gè)數(shù)據(jù)庫(kù)無法啟動(dòng)和使用。

  看到網(wǎng)上有不少人推薦使用scsi_id來綁定,于是想把現(xiàn)有的轉(zhuǎn)換過去,動(dòng)手做做吧。沒想到遇到的第1個(gè)難題就是vmware workstation無法識(shí)別scsi_id的問題,用vbox就沒問題,還好網(wǎng)絡(luò)上有找到解決方案,編輯虛擬機(jī)增加參數(shù):disk.EnableUUID = "TRUE"這樣就能讓vmware workstation正確識(shí)別到scsi_id了。

  首先看下現(xiàn)在的綁定規(guī)則情況如下:/dev/sdb /dev/raw/raw1 ocr /dev/sdc /dev/raw/raw2 voting /dev/sdd /dev/raw/raw3 asmdisk1 /dev/sde /dev/raw/raw4 asmdisk2

  接著開始配置新規(guī)則,在/etc/udev/rules.d目錄下新建一個(gè)文件99-oracle.rules,內(nèi)容如下:K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id -g -u -s %p", RESULT=="36000c297628f8969e1738bd9218aa814", RUN+="/bin/raw /dev/raw/raw1 %N", NAME="ocr-disk", OWNER="oracle", GROUP="oinstall", MODE="0640" K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id -g -u -s %p", RESULT=="36000c290c598768a2edf15a267e4d52c", RUN+="/bin/raw /dev/raw/raw2 %N", NAME="voting-disk", OWNER="oracle", GROUP="oinstall", MODE="0640" K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id -g -u -s %p", RESULT=="36000c2996ec122dead7aee84b7295271", RUN+="/bin/raw /dev/raw/raw3 %N",NAME="asm-disk1", OWNER="oracle", GROUP="oinstall", MODE="0640" K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id -g -u -s %p", RESULT=="36000c29a6c4e9283e031dfbf465b7ae8", RUN+="/bin/raw /dev/raw/raw4 %N",NAME="asm-disk2", OWNER="oracle", GROUP="oinstall", MODE="0640"

  另外還有權(quán)限的問題,通過/etc/rc.d/rc.local來開機(jī)執(zhí)行授權(quán),增加如下內(nèi)容:chown oracle:oinstall /dev/raw/raw1 chown oracle:oinstall /dev/raw/raw2 chown oracle:oinstall /dev/raw/raw3 chown oracle:oinstall /dev/raw/raw4 chmod 640 /dev/raw/raw1 chmod 640 /dev/raw/raw2 chmod 640 /dev/raw/raw3 chmod 640 /dev/raw/raw4同時(shí)將原來的綁定規(guī)則文件移除。

  啟動(dòng)udev /sbin/udevcontrol reload_rules /sbin/start_udev

  重啟系統(tǒng)后驗(yàn)證下結(jié)果。

  [root@R1 ~]# ll /dev/*-disk* brw-r—— 1 oracle oinstall 8, 65 02-03 20:00 /dev/asm-disk1 brw-r—— 1 oracle oinstall 8, 81 02-03 20:00 /dev/asm-disk2 brw-r—— 1 oracle oinstall 8, 33 02-03 20:00 /dev/ocr-disk brw-r—— 1 oracle oinstall 8, 49 02-03 20:00 /dev/voting-disk [root@R1 ~]# ll /dev/raw/raw* crw-r—— 1 oracle oinstall 162, 1 02-03 20:00 /dev/raw/raw1 crw-r—— 1 oracle oinstall 162, 2 02-03 20:00 /dev/raw/raw2 crw-r—— 1 oracle oinstall 162, 3 02-03 20:00 /dev/raw/raw3 crw-r—— 1 oracle oinstall 162, 4 02-03 20:00 /dev/raw/raw4

  這樣就能夠正常使用db了,增加新的設(shè)備也不用擔(dān)心出現(xiàn)問題了。

  附,獲取設(shè)備命令和參數(shù):scsi_id -g -v -s /block/sda或者for i in a ;do echo "sd$i" "`scsi_id -g -u -s /block/sd$i` ";done或者for i in b c d e;do echo "KERNEL==\"sd*\", BUS==\"scsi\", PROGRAM==\"/sbin/scsi_id -g -u -s %p\", RESULT==\"`scsi_id -g -u -s /block/sd$i`\", NAME=\"asm-disk$i\", OWNER=\"oracle\", GROUP=\"oinstall\", MODE=\"0660\"" done注意的是默認(rèn)情況下生成的鏈接在/dev下面,如果你像我一樣指定到不同地方需要而外的參數(shù),參考上面的RUN部分。

  -The End-

相關(guān)文章

無相關(guān)信息
更新時(shí)間2022-03-13 11:11:03【至頂部↑】
聯(lián)系我們 | 郵件: | 客服熱線電話:4008816886(QQ同號(hào)) | 

付款方式留言簿投訴中心網(wǎng)站糾錯(cuò)二維碼手機(jī)版

客服電話: